diff --git a/src/streamers/deezer/main.ts b/src/streamers/deezer/main.ts index 49dad6c..df1c3b4 100644 --- a/src/streamers/deezer/main.ts +++ b/src/streamers/deezer/main.ts @@ -280,7 +280,7 @@ export default class Deezer implements StreamerWithLogin { tracks: SONGS.data.map(parseTrack) } - if (!data.metadata.trackCount) data.metadata.trackCount = data.tracks.length + if (!data.metadata.trackCount) data.metadata.trackCount = data.tracks.length return data } diff --git a/src/streamers/deezer/parse.ts b/src/streamers/deezer/parse.ts index 9b97a59..8a41b1c 100644 --- a/src/streamers/deezer/parse.ts +++ b/src/streamers/deezer/parse.ts @@ -143,9 +143,16 @@ export interface DeezerTrack { } export function parseTrack(track: DeezerTrack): Track { - let addt: {regions?: string[], copyright?: string, producers?: string[], composers?: string[], lyricists?: string[]} = {} + const addt: { + regions?: string[] + copyright?: string + producers?: string[] + composers?: string[] + lyricists?: string[] + } = {} - if (track?.AVAILABLE_COUNTRIES?.STREAM_ADS) addt.regions = [...track.AVAILABLE_COUNTRIES.STREAM_ADS] + if (track?.AVAILABLE_COUNTRIES?.STREAM_ADS) + addt.regions = [...track.AVAILABLE_COUNTRIES.STREAM_ADS] if (track?.COPYRIGHT) addt.copyright = track.COPYRIGHT if (track.SNG_CONTRIBUTORS?.producer) addt.producers = track.SNG_CONTRIBUTORS?.producer if (track.SNG_CONTRIBUTORS?.composer) addt.composers = track.SNG_CONTRIBUTORS?.composer diff --git a/src/streamers/tidal/main.ts b/src/streamers/tidal/main.ts index 1b2eac2..e306616 100644 --- a/src/streamers/tidal/main.ts +++ b/src/streamers/tidal/main.ts @@ -428,7 +428,7 @@ export default class Tidal implements Streamer { }) const sessionData = await sessionResponse.json() - this.userId = sessionData.userId + this.userId = sessionData.userId this.countryCode = sessionData.countryCode } const subscription = (